Output 8c5122cb82bc8112028b16e4e1734c765b3ae8ea847aa5fc17f09b1465e3b45a:0

value
17600000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 537f372649c3521da4d19d4937f7ce2b91787fbc OP_EQUAL
address
39JWQYmf5Z64wvYSwtAypMou5bZipNYx9H
transaction
8c5122cb82bc8112028b16e4e1734c765b3ae8ea847aa5fc17f09b1465e3b45a
spent
true